Melco Resorts & Entertainment Ltd
Melco Resorts & Entertainment Limited develops, owns, and operates casino gaming and resort facilities in Asia and Europe. It owns and operates City of Dreams, an integrated casino resort that has gaming tables and gaming machines; suites and villas; restaurants and bars; retail outlets; a wet stage performance theater; and recreation and leisure facilities. Melco Resorts & Entertainment Ltd (MLCO) - Total Assets
Latest total assets as of December 2025: $7.60 Billion USD
Based on the latest financial reports, Melco Resorts & Entertainment Ltd (MLCO) holds total assets worth $7.60 Billion USD as of December 2025.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Annual Total Assets for Melco Resorts & Entertainment Ltd (2003–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Melco Resorts & Entertainment Ltd from 2003 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$7.60 Billion | -4.85% |
| 2024-12-31 | $7.99 Billion | -4.20% |
| 2023-12-31 | $8.34 Billion | -10.39% |
| 2022-12-31 | $9.30 Billion | +4.71% |
| 2021-12-31 | $8.88 Billion | -1.52% |
| 2020-12-31 | $9.02 Billion | -4.93% |
| 2019-12-31 | $9.49 Billion | +6.88% |
| 2018-12-31 | $8.88 Billion | -0.20% |
| 2017-12-31 | $8.90 Billion | -4.77% |
| 2016-12-31 | $9.34 Billion | -10.27% |
| 2015-12-31 | $10.41 Billion | -0.22% |
| 2014-12-31 | $10.43 Billion | +18.37% |
| 2013-12-31 | $8.81 Billion | +56.79% |
| 2012-12-31 | $5.62 Billion | -10.34% |
| 2011-12-31 | $6.27 Billion | +28.37% |
| 2010-12-31 | $4.88 Billion | -0.33% |
| 2009-12-31 | $4.90 Billion | +8.94% |
| 2008-12-31 | $4.50 Billion | +24.25% |
| 2007-12-31 | $3.62 Billion | +58.79% |
| 2006-12-31 | $2.28 Billion | +441.28% |
| 2005-12-31 | $421.21 Million | +296.95% |
| 2004-12-31 | $106.11 Million | +4921.86% |
| 2003-12-31 | $2.11 Million | -- |
